Echo Doppler generally quantizes only to half or full beats. However, using parameter multiplication, you can achieve a "3/4 beat" echo. By modifying the value of Slider 2 (Delay), you can lock in a specific timing: effect "echodoppler" active & effect "echodoppler" button 2 & param_multiply 75% & effect "echodoppler" slider 2 This sets the delay to precisely 75% of a beat, creating an off-grid shuffling effect.

The simplest form of mapping involves using the following VDJscript command: effect_active 'echoDoppler' & effect_button 3 This command does two things at once: it activates the Echo Doppler effect and simultaneously presses its third button, which in this case sets the beat synchronization.
The "Virtual DJ Echo Doppler" effect is a specialized audio processing technique used by digital DJs to simulate physical motion and depth. By combining delay-based feedback with pitch manipulation, it creates the illusion of a sound source moving rapidly toward or away from the listener. Conceptual Foundation
